What's the Role?

Guaranteed Rate is currently seeking a hard-working, dedicated Reverse Mortgage Sr. Processor to join our innovative and passionate team.

Responsibilities:

  • Work closely with our Loan Officers to ensure a timely and accurate experience for our clients—from home buyers to refinancers—throughout the entire Reverse mortgage process
  • Prepare, review and ensure the timely delivery of all loan disclosures to your clients in accordance with all governmental and investor requirements
  • Order and review all necessary Reverse Mortgage borrower and 3rd party documents, including but not limited to appraisal and title documentation, as well as all required credit and underwriting documentation
  • Submit complete loan files for underwriting review
  • Scheduling and tracking of closing dates, contingency dates, and document expiration dates
  • Work with clients directly to obtain all necessary conditions needed for final approval, including continuous follow-through to ensure documents are received timely and loan closing within required SLA’s
  • Communicate with LO, Client, Realtors (as applicable) on periodic status updates
  • Use state of the art technology to manage your loan pipeline

Qualifications:

  • At least 3 years of recent Reverse mortgage experience in a Processor role in the residential mortgage industry
  • Experience with Quantum Software a must
  • Experience in HECM and Jumbo, Reverse, HomeSafe, Platinum, Choice products
  • Excellent disposition, mindset, communication skills and work ethic
  • To be adept to reviewing and analyzing income documents, including calculating income from salaried and self-employed individuals
  • To be a self-starter with a strong desire to learn and be a member of an innovative winning team
  • Ability to multi-task with strong attention to detail while meeting deadlines in a fast-paced environment
  • Strong listening, problem solving skills and out of box thinking
  • An inherent desire to serve clients in order to create something unique and fantastic
  • A commitment to integrity and customer service
